Wraith
19th June 2009, 09:44 AM
im sure if you found a full wrecked car with an LS1 you could do it for about 15

To transform a Cali into a fully fledged, properly built, engineered and street legal vehicle with V8 and RWD conversion, you would need at least a 40-45k budget with about 8k of that used on a brand new crate LS1...

Even if you are able to score the V8 engine for nothing and do some of the works yourself, you would still need 10's of thousands (at least 20-30k) to complete the 100's of other requirements needed for such a build - 15k will only get you started, in fact 15k wouldn't even have been enough 20 years ago ! I know cause I built an XU-1 Torana like this in the mid-late 80's ;)
